Python source code | |||
---|---|---|---|
from scipy.special import erf
from numpy import *
from matplotlib.pyplot import *
cdf = lambda a,x: erf(x/(a*sqrt(2.))) - (x*exp(-x*x/(2*a*a))*sqrt(2/pi)/a)
fig = figure(figsize=(5,5))
ax = fig.add_subplot(111)
ax.grid(True)
ax.minorticks_on()
x = linspace(.001,20,150)
ax.plot(x,cdf(1,x),label=r"a=1",linewidth=2)
ax.plot(x,cdf(2,x),'r',label=r"a=2",linewidth=2)
ax.plot(x,cdf(5,x),'g',label=r"a=5",linewidth=2)
ax.set_ylim(0,1.05)
ax.set_xlim(0,20)
ax.set_xlabel(r'x')
ax.set_ylabel(r'CDF')
ax.legend(loc=4)
fig.savefig("Maxwell-Boltzmann_distribution_cdf.svg",bbox_inches="tight",pad_inches=.15)
